About Partial Hospitalization
Positive Recovery Center’s Partial Hospitalization Program is the most intensive form of outpatient treatment available. Sometimes referred to as “day treatment,” PHP is very similar to an intensive outpatient program (IOP) in that it is comprised of individual therapy, group therapy, psychoeducation, life skills development, and family therapy.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P)
An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P) is an addiction treatment program that is designed for clients who are ready to return to work, school, and other responsibilities or who do not require a higher level of care. Unlike residential treatment programs, IOP does not require that clients live onsite at the rehab center. Instead, many IOP clients live in their homes, at a sober living house or in another safe living environment while they complete treatment. Aftercare Program
An aftercare program for addiction recovery encourages permanent change and lasting sobriety as you make the transition from rehab back to an independent lifestyle. Aftercare is designed to help you stay engaged in your recovery by connecting with other sober individuals, reinforcing life skills and behavioral changes, and managing any recurrence of symptoms while minimizing the damage caused by relapse.
